Connecting with clients is a crucial skill for any peer support worker. You need to build trust, rapport, and empathy with the people you are helping. But sometimes, your team may struggle to communicate effectively, understand the client's perspective, or handle difficult emotions. How can you make your team and your clients feel more at ease?
